Boniface May receipts the Union stockyards in to nine o clock tuesday morning consisted of to cattle 14 0 calves i 105 hogs and five sheep and lambs. In addition to deliveries expected to come off trucks there arc a further two cars of Stock reported. To arrive in the Yards by rail. With a fairly satisfactory clean up on the cattle Market monday and new arrivals proving of Model ate dimensions he Trade was ported generally Active again tues Day with some underlying strength being uncovered for virtually All lines of killing material. Despite very Little support to elate this week on Southern account the Market is displaying a reasonably Good performance with most transactions ruling definitely in Tavor of the i Selling Side of the Trade i unc Van Ness is characterizing the i Market which is usually associated with Light runs and while sales in some instances can scarcely be quoted very Little different from Hist week in other eases transactions arc bordering around 25c higher. Gunnar Security markets new King Leopold s surrender of the belgian army today Sharp declines in world Security and commodity markets and unsettled the currencies of belligerent nations. First repercussion of the surrender was heavy Selling on the new York s Ock Market. Opening dealings were marked by turnover in individual issues rang ing to shares and prices of leading issues were Olf is much a. 7% Points in Bethlehem steel. Some stocks declined further alter the opening but in most instances the Day ? lows were registered in the first hour. Thereafter the Market steadied. Recoveries in some instances amounted to Lour Points although very few issues were Able to net Back to the previous close. Gilbert a. Toronto Stock Market tumbled to new Low prices Lor the year tuesday for Index groups As dozens of issues hit Lhoir lows for the year or longer. Index losses ranged up to about 5 Points in Industrial and Gold groups. Volume expanded to shares the Price Lone improved slightly in tiie last 10 minutes. Price declines Between sales Large to 10 cents times in secondary mining lists. Buffalo Ank Erite dropped 75 cents to 3.25. Hollinger dropped go to its lowest Price in 3 year and net decline of 20 1.750-n. In shipping circles is understood that 21 ships have been placed on berth Here in tune with about the same number for july although past experience has aught the Trade Here that the full lumber of ships listed is not always forthcoming. Even taking 15 ships for ouch of the next two months a Var go.000 tons would be loaded local elevators. There was no Grain loadings receipts Over the week end and stocks remain bushels of All grains. Clearances this sea Lake navigation steady Progress with seeding operations has Iorii Nuell during the two under generally Luvito Able conditions in All parts of Canada no cording to the second crop report issued this by the Ogilvie flour Mills company limited. The1 Ideal conditions have been favourable for Strong. Even and Plant do in the Early Fields Pennis cd uninterrupted work in the later areas. In some parts of Manitoba and Saskatchewan however More rain i needed very soon to maintain consistent crop developments this is chiefly in Central and Northern districts where the sub i Oil is dry.
